文章:

在当今移动应用开发领域,iOS平台一直以其卓越的用户体验和强大的功能而备受推崇。然而,对于许多开发人员来说,他们可能习惯于使用Windows操作系统进行开发工作。那么,有没有可能在Windows环境下开发iOS应用呢?让我们一起来探索Windows开发iOS应用的新趋势。

过去,要在Windows操作系统上开发iOS应用并非易事。这主要是因为iOS开发通常需要使用苹果公司提供的Xcode集成开发环境(IDE),而Xcode只能在macOS上运行。这一限制使得许多开发人员在选择开发平台时不得不放弃Windows。然而,随着技术的不断进步和开发工具的发展,如今在Windows上开发iOS应用变得更加可行。

一种方法是利用虚拟机或模拟器来创建一个运行macOS的虚拟环境。通过安装虚拟机软件,如VMware或VirtualBox,并在其中安装macOS,开发人员可以在Windows上模拟运行macOS系统,从而获得在Windows环境下进行iOS开发的能力。这种方法虽然可行,但在性能和稳定性方面可能存在一些挑战。

另一种方法是使用跨平台开发工具,例如React Native、Flutter和Xamarin等。这些工具允许开发人员使用一种通用的编程语言和框架来编写应用程序,然后将其转换为适用于多个平台的原生应用。这样,开发人员可以在Windows上使用他们熟悉的工具和环境来创建iOS应用,而无需直接运行macOS系统。